Medicines

Many people suffering from ADHD discover that what medication is given for adhd can help to control their symptoms and improve their functioning. However, they aren't without side effects. There is also the possibility that the drug can result in dependence or addiction. It is crucial to talk to an expert in mental health regarding the options available if or your child is considering medication.

iampsychiatry-logo-wide.pngStimulant drugs, such as amphetamine or methylphenidate, increase and regulate levels of brain chemicals known as neurotransmitters. These medications can also help increase focus and concentration. These drugs can be prescribed in the form of pills or liquids, and taken by mouth. For [Redirect Only] children, doctors generally begin with a small amount of the medication and gradually increase the dosage over a period of time. If the medication isn't tolerated well, a doctor will try another stimulant or a nonstimulant drug.

Non-stimulant medicines, like atomoxetine and antidepressants such as bupropion, work slower than stimulants but they can still help improve focus. These medications are a good alternative for people who are unable to take stimulants due to health issues or severe side-effects. Medications that act as a mood stabilizer such as lithium are also used to treat ADHD in adults. These medications have a relaxing effect and can ease depression, but they can cause other serious side effects like seizures in some people.

Alternatives to medication

There are many treatment options for adhd and depression medication, including cognitive behavioral therapy and coaching techniques. Some people with ADHD prefer to use supplements, but these are not controlled by the FDA and should only be taken under the supervision of a medical professional.

Stimulant medications, such as Adderall and Ritalin, are the most frequently prescribed treatment for ADHD in children. These drugs increase the signaling between nerves and the regions of the brain, which allows kids to concentrate and control impulsivity. These medications also aid children to focus and stay on track in school and at home. Unfortunately, these medications can cause adverse side consequences. Some of them include a loss of appetite, trouble sleeping, and sleepiness. The controlled substance status of stimulants means that they must be prescribed by doctors. Several alternatives to stimulant medications are available, such as atomoxetine (Strattera) Guanfacine XR, and clonidine XR, which are not as effective as stimulants but have less adverse consequences.

For adults suffering from ADHD, cognitive behavioral therapy can help reduce symptoms without the need for medication. In this type of therapy, a therapist tries to alter negative thinking patterns. People who suffer from ADHD for instance tend to think about everything or nothing, assuming they are either perfect or fail. CBT seeks to teach individuals healthier ways of thinking and coping with problems and stress.

Certain people with ADHD prefer to use natural treatments, such as diet and lifestyle changes, to avoid the potential side effects of medications. There isn't any evidence to prove that these treatments are effective. Furthermore, removing certain foods can cause nutritional deficiencies and lead to more serious health problems. Therefore, it is important to consult a medical professional before making any dietary changes.

In addition to abstaining from processed and sugary foods and drinks, those who suffer from ADHD must ensure that they take plenty of exercise and sleep. Sleeping enough is important for all people, but it's particularly important for people with ADHD. It's also best to stick to a regular schedule and stick to it. Avoid nicotine and caffeine as they can aggravate ADHD symptoms.

Lifestyle changes

In the wake of a lack of ADHD medications, a lot of families are looking for natural alternatives. Lifestyle changes include diet and supplements, as well as sleep routines. They can also include meditation, exercise, and cognitive behavioral therapy. These methods can help alleviate symptoms and improve focus. Some experts suggest an enriched diet that contains omegas, vitamins and minerals as well as avoiding stimulants like caffeine and sugar, as well as limiting processed foods. Some experts suggest an elimination diet, which involves eliminating foods that can cause symptoms.

A good night's sleep is critical for people with ADHD. A restful night's sleep can help reduce hyperactivity and inattention, as well as improve concentration. It is important to go to bed at the same time each night and to avoid stimulants such as caffeine before the time you go to bed. You can also try an easy wind-down routine like listening to calming music or reading.

Regular physical activity can reduce hyperactive and impulsive behaviors. It can also improve mood and sleep quality. Swimming and running are two repetitive activities that can help calm the nervous system. A good workout plan should include both cardio and strength training.

A well-balanced diet is essential for adults with ADHD. It should include plenty of fruits, vegetables lean protein, and healthy fats. It should also be low in sodium, sugar and trans fats. It is also recommended to stay clear of caffeine and alcohol. Symptoms of ADHD can be triggered by certain food items, so trying an elimination diet is a good way to see whether certain foods cause or worsen symptoms.
